Web hosts usually offer add-ons with their packages, the features differ between each host. Make sure you are comparing apples to apples by selecting plans which are similar. A cheaper host may not have the same level of features as one that costs a bit more but has a more robust plan.

Find out what kinds of sites a service hosts. Some free hosting sites do not allow you to add your own unique language scripts. If you need dynamic scripting for your website, you may have to pay a web host for that service.

Make sure that your domain name is registered by you and not your hosting provider so that you can keep it should you change providers. Your hosting provider will control the registration of your domain instead of you.

You need to decide whether shared or dedicated hosting. If you have a huge and complicated site that receives tons of visitors, a shared server might limit you and lead to a lot of downtime. It is probably a good idea to look for a web host that is dedicated.

Choose a host that does not have constant outages. Don’t listen to their excuses! Any company that makes excuses for lengthy outages. Frequent downtime demonstrates a poor business model, so do not make a commitment to such a company.

When you are considering who to use for web hosting, choose a company located in the country of your target audience. If you need to target people in a certain country, make sure that your hosting company has their business located in that country.

Choose monthly payments instead of subscribing for a web host. You have no way of knowing what your business) will be a year from now. If your host goes down or if your business takes off, you’ll lose out on what you’ve already paid.

The company you choose must be one that will accommodate your future needs. If you plan to add videos or pictures to your site, you will need more space than a site that uses basic HTML scripting. You’ll want to have at least 100 megabytes of space allotted to your account with the ability to add more at a reasonable price.

Service charges coming from hosting providers could be correlated to the traffic your site generates in some time period. Ask your host how your bill will be computed. You may find that you are going to be billed a flat rate or based on the traffic that your site experiences.

Check on whether or not your web host you are interested in offers a money back guarantee. If you find the hosting service isn’t right for you within the first 30 days after ordering it, there should be some stipulation in the contract that states you can cancel the contract and get your money back. To ensure a safe website, it may be wise to pay a little extra to obtain the secure server certificate. You can add an icon to your website which informs users that your site is secure, and this can make them more trusting of the transaction security on your site.

Don’t join a free web hosting simply due to the fact that it’s free. Free hosting services usually includes displaying ads on your site. You have no say in the advertisements that will need to post.

Choose a web host that offers SEO help to boost site traffic. This will get your site registered on search engines. It may be better to register it yourself, however, since you can add detailed descriptions to help rank your site better.
